#f7194b h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#f7194b is composed of 96.9% red, 9.8% green and 29.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 89.9% magenta, 69.6% yellow and 3.1% black. It has a hue angle of 346.5 degrees, a saturation of 93.3% and a lightness of 53.3%. #f7194b color hex could be obtained by blending #ff3296 with #ef0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ff0033.

● #f7194b color description : Vivid red.
The hexadecimal color #f7194b has RGB values of R:247, G:25, B:75 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.9, Y:0.7, K:0.03. Its decimal value is 16193867.
